This Sunday (20), Corinthians will host Flamengo at Neo Química Arena, for the second leg of the Copa do Brasil semifinals. Once again expecting a full house, the Faithful Crowd will have even more reasons to enjoy the celebration. This is because the club's main sponsor, Esportes da Sorte, is preparing a series of actions for the arrival of the fans, before the decisive match.
One of these will be the 'ticket upgrade', where the sponsor will surprise some of the fans heading to the stands and take them to watch the game directly from the Esportes da Sorte box.
Another highlight action planned is the distribution of Memphis bands, in reference to the accessory used on the field by the Dutch forward, which has become a craze among fans in the stadiums. At the game against Flamengo, a personalized version will be given by Esportes da Sorte to the fans, upon betting on the platform.
Similarly, other personalized gifts will also be available for the Faithful Crowd, such as buckets, caps, and cups, through promoters of the betting platform, which will also conduct interactions between the audience and the company's mascot, Edson, in photo sessions with the fans.
Completing the actions, influencers Vino and Seila, well-known by the alvinegra crowd on social networks, will be covering the game.
“Since the beginning of this partnership, we have sought to literally wear the club's colors. The purpose of this new action is to contribute to the beautiful celebration that the Faithful Crowd makes in the stadiums, in addition to carrying out activations that connect the brand even more with the fans. This is our great search,” states Sofia Aldin, marketing director of the Esportes da Sorte Group.
